The main difference between protostomes and deuterostomes is the sequence in which the mouth and anus develop during embryonic development. Protostomes develop a mouth first, and deuterostomes form an anus first.

Explanation:

The primary difference between protostomes and deuterostomes lies in the sequence of their embryonic development.

Protostomes, which include organisms like insects and mollusks, follow a developmental sequence where the first opening in the embryo becomes the mouth, and the second becomes the anus.

On the other hand, deuterostomes, including organisms like vertebrates and echinoderms, have a developmental sequence where the first opening becomes the anus, and the second becomes the mouth.

_____ allow materials to be exchanged between the blood and tissues, _____ carry blood towards the heart, and _____ carry blood away from the heart.

Answers

Capillaries; veins; arteries

Capillaries allow materials to be exchanged between the blood and tissues, veins carry blood towards the heart, and arteries carry blood away from the heart.

Capillaries are small blood vessels through which molecules such as oxygen and glucose enter the cells.  

Veins are tubes or blood vessels that transport blood toward the heart. Veins mostly transport deoxygenated blood towards the heart except the pulmonary and umbilical veins, which transports oxygenated blood toward heart.

Arteries are blood vessels that transport blood away from the heart to other parts of the body. Arteries have elastic walls and they are stronger and thicker than veins.
